Description:

Experience the historic Pearl Harbor and the Punchbowl National Cemetery of the Pacific as well as Downtown Honolulu from a whole new view on our Double Decker Tour. Drive through downtown and see Honolulu's highlights including Iolani Palace, the State Capitol, King Kamehameha Statue and Honolulu Hale before continuing on for a one of a kind view of the revered Punchbowl National Cemetery of the Pacific. Continue south until you reach Pearl Harbor, a must for any visitor.

On this tour your visit to the Arizona Memorial and Pearl Harbor will transport you to the morning of December 7, 1941 as you re-live the moment that thrust America into World War II. At the Arizona Memorial Visitor Center, Hawaii's number one visitor attraction, you will view the film of the attack and browse through the historic artifacts on display. You will ride the Navy launch across Pearl Harbor to board the Arizona Memorial.

Terms & Conditions
  • The US Department of the Interior has declared a, "no bags" policy at the Arizona Memorial and Visitor Center. Passengers may not carry any concealing items. This includes purses, handbags, backpacks, diaper bags, etc.
  • Small cameras are permitted.
  • Allowable vital items may be placed in your pockets. Do not leave any valuables on the bus.
  • Due to ceremonies on December 7th each year, the park is closed to commercial vehicles and we do not operate our normal tours to the USS Arizona Memorial on that date.
  • Also, on rare occasions, and due to external factors outside of our control (including inclement weather and/or shortages of boat launch tickets), there is the possibility of not being able to visit the Arizona Memorial during your visit.
